Kolukkumalai Tea Estate is the highest tea estate in the world, located at an altitude of 8000ft above sea level. The drive to the estate is an adventure in itself, as you will be driving through the winding roads of the Western Ghats. Once you reach the estate, you can take a guided tour to see the tea-making process and enjoy the stunning views of the surrounding hills. You can also take a trek to Meesapulimala, the second-highest peak in South India, which offers panoramic views of the Western Ghats.
Thekkady is a nature lover's paradise, located in the Periyar National Park. You can take a boat ride on the Periyar Lake and spot elephants, tigers, and other wildlife. You can also take a jungle trek or go bamboo rafting in the park. Don't miss the opportunity to visit the spice plantations in Thekkady, where you can learn about different spices and their uses in Indian cuisine.
